Abstract

A method for outputting a blend shape value includes: performing feature extraction on obtained target audio data to obtain a target audio feature vector; inputting the target audio feature vector and a target identifier into an audio-driven animation model; inputting the target audio feature vector into an audio encoding layer, determining an input feature vector of a next layer at a (2t−n)/2 time point based on an input feature vector of a previous layer between a t time point and a t−n time point, determining a feature vector having a causal relationship with the input feature vector of the previous layer as a valid feature vector, outputting sequentially target-audio encoding features, and inputting the target identifier into a one-hot encoding layer for binary vector encoding to obtain a target-identifier encoding feature; and outputting a blend shape value corresponding to the target audio data.
